The Right Budget Formula

The right budget depends on three specific numbers: your target cost per lead, your close rate, and your customer lifetime value. Once you know those, the math is simple.

Step 1: Calculate Your Target Cost Per Lead

This is the most important number in your entire Google Ads strategy.

Cost Per Lead (CPL) = How much you can afford to pay for one lead.

The Formula:

(Avg Customer Value × Close Rate × Profit Margin) ÷ 3 = Max Cost Per Lead

We divide by 3 because you want to be profitable, not break even.

Real Examples

Example 1: HVAC Company

• Average customer value: $4,500 | Close rate: 30% | Profit margin: 20%

Result: $90 max cost per lead

Example 2: Local Plumber

• Average customer value: $850 | Close rate: 25% | Profit margin: 18%

Result: $12.75 max cost per lead

Example 3: Roofing Company

• Average customer value: $12,000 | Close rate: 35% | Profit margin: 22%

Result: $308 max cost per lead

What to Expect at Different Budget Levels

$300 to $500/month

5 to 15 leads/month

The Testing Zone

Limited campaigns, basic structure, slower optimization. Great for testing or niche services.

Best for:

  • Brand new businesses
  • Niche services
  • High close rates (40%+)
  • Cheap clicks ($2-$5 CPC)

⚠️ Reality Check:

Requires perfect execution. One weak link kills ROI.

$1,000 to $2,000/month

15 to 50 leads/month

The Sweet Spot

Multi-campaign structure, geographic flexibility, faster optimization. Consistent results.

Best for:

  • Local service businesses
  • Professional services
  • Established businesses
  • Ready to commit 90 days

⚠️ Reality Check:

Success depends on management quality.

$3,000 to $5,000/month

50 to 150+ leads/month

The Scaling Zone

Dominate your market, multiple services, competitor conquest campaigns.

Best for:

  • Proven sales systems
  • Multi-location businesses
  • High-value services
  • Ready to scale fast

⚠️ Reality Check:

Requires strong operations and professional management.

$7,500+/month

150+ leads/month

The Domination Zone

Complete market coverage, multi-channel strategies, full-funnel campaigns.

Best for:

  • Established businesses
  • Franchises/multi-location
  • High-ticket B2B
  • Scaling nationally

⚠️ Reality Check:

Needs strong operations and fast fulfillment.

Quick Reference by Industry (2025 Averages)

IndustryAvg CPCStarting Budget
HVAC$15-$35$1,500-$3,000/month
Plumbing$10-$25$1,000-$2,000/month
Roofing$20-$50$2,000-$4,000/month
Legal$40-$150$3,000-$8,000/month
Pest Control$5-$15$500-$1,500/month
Cleaning Services$5-$12$500-$1,200/month
Landscaping$8-$20$800-$2,000/month
Electrician$12-$28$1,200-$2,500/month

Common Budget Mistakes to Avoid

Spreading Budget Too Thin

Running 5 different campaigns with $200/month each means not enough data to optimize. Focus your budget on your #1 highest-value service first.

Starting Too Big

Launching with $5,000/month before proving anything works wastes money. Start conservative and prove ROI before scaling.

Quitting Too Soon

Google Ads takes 60-90 days to optimize. Commit to 90 days minimum. Track weekly improvements and adjust strategy but stay consistent.

Trusting Google's Recommendations Blindly

Google makes money when YOU spend money. Only increase budget when YOUR data shows you're profitable and need more volume.

Frequently Asked Questions

What if I can only afford $300/month? Should I even bother?+
Depends on your industry. If you're in a low-competition niche with cheap clicks ($3 to $7), yes, you can make $300/month work. But you need expert management and perfect execution. If you're in high-competition industries like legal or insurance, $300/month won't move the needle. Save up or focus on other channels first.
Can I start small and increase budget later?+
Absolutely. That's exactly what we recommend. Start with a conservative budget, prove ROI, then scale. It's way smarter than blowing $5,000 in Month 1 with no idea what you're doing.
How long before I see results?+
Expect 30 to 90 days. You'll get leads immediately (usually within the first week), but it takes 60 to 90 days to optimize campaigns and really hit your stride. Anyone promising instant ROI is lying.
What if I'm competing against big companies with huge budgets?+
You don't need to match their budgets. You need to be SMARTER. Tighter targeting, better landing pages, faster follow-up, and local focus beat big budgets all the time. We help small businesses compete with regional and national players every day.
Should I manage Google Ads myself or hire someone?+
If you have time to learn, test, and optimize for 10+ hours per week, DIY can work. But most business owners don't have that time. The cost of bad management (wasted ad spend) usually exceeds the cost of hiring an expert. Do the math on your time value.
What if my budget runs out mid-month?+
Two options: Either increase your budget so ads run all month, OR set up ad scheduling so your ads only show during your best hours (when you can actually answer the phone). Don't let ads run 24/7 if you can't afford full month coverage.
